| Morphology: | On YM medium at 25°C after 6 days, colonies creamy white to dingy white, smooth to faintly wrinkled, raised, margin filamentous. Cells hyaline, smooth, ovoid to ellipsoidal, guttulate, 6-9 X 4.5 µm. Pseudohyphae abundant. |
